Network Flexibility

Definition ∞ Network flexibility refers to a blockchain’s capacity to adapt to changing operational requirements, such as supporting diverse application types or adjusting to varying transaction loads. This includes the ability to upgrade protocols, integrate new features, or support custom virtual environments. A flexible network can evolve to meet future demands without requiring hard forks or significant disruptions. It promotes long-term viability and innovation.
Context ∞ In crypto news, network flexibility is often discussed in relation to protocol upgrades and the ability of a blockchain to support a wide array of decentralized applications. Debates frequently involve the governance mechanisms that allow for such adaptability and the technical architecture that facilitates modifications. Observing a network’s flexibility provides insight into its potential for sustained growth and its capacity to remain competitive.
